Birijanga is a Rural village located in Kuakhia, Jajapur, Odisha.
The total population of Birijanga is 158.
Birijanga village comprises 41 households.
The literacy rate in Birijanga is 80.6%. Among the literate population of 112, there are 64 literate males and 48 literate females.
In Birijanga, there are 80 males and 78 females, with a sex ratio of 975 females per 1000 males.
There are 19 children (12% of population), comprising 7 boys and 12 girls.
The total number of workers in Birijanga is 44, with 44 main workers and 0 marginal workers.
In Birijanga, there are 34 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(18 males, 16 females) and 0 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(0 males, 0 females).
Birijanga is located in Odisha state, Jajapur district, and falls under Kuakhia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 401508 and LGD code is 401508.
